Legislative:  Chair:  Neena VanCamp

Neena has not heard of any activity in the Kentucky or Indiana legislature.

In Ohio SB 189 (making vicious dogs behavior specific rather than breed specific) has been introduced and second hearing on it with “open” testimony will be Wednesday, May 18.  Neena will be there and she will update folks how it is progressing.

2006 Specialty:  Chair:  JoAnn Ruehl, Teresa Fishback assistant chair

All applications have been filed with the AKC on May 24, 2005.  All contracts have been signed.

Photographer Kathy Brandt will be the official photographer.  She puts your pictures on discs and you will be able to see what they look like before you order them.  Payment by credit card is to be made before the pictures will be made.  Kathy has done the Lakeshore Specialty and is doing the National so you will be able to see her work then.

 

Special features will be an obedience demo by Jean Fordyce and an agility demo by Chester Fordyce or vice versa.

 

A TDI testing will be done by former member, Peggy Crawford at a cost of $20.00.  The club will earn $10.00 for every dog tested.  If anyone is a certified CGC tester, please consider volunteering to do this for the club. 

 

JoAnn would like suggestions for a raffle or some other moneymaking scheme to help with costs other than the silent auction.  She reports that we will not have the amount of walk-by traffic which we had in ’05 that Neena did so well with, so we need something else.

 

Marilyn Midkiff will be collecting for trophy sponsorship in July.  We will not be having rosettes from an outside source as Onofrio is going to supply them thus the cost for trophies will be less.  They will be the same lovely ones as last year but different pieces.

 

We will have outside vendors.  Their cost for a table will be equivalent to at least a $25.00 item.
